dc.description.abstractThis project report is a collection of the work produced in work package 1 and work package 2 in the TEAPOT-project. The main objective of the TEAPOT project is to "Secure positioning for the future transport system under Nordic conditions", while work package 1 specifically is on "Cross-sectoral collaboration and demands for positioning in the transport sector" and work package 2 on " Positioning and introduction of sensor fusion systems for driving in the Nordic region". The partners of the TEAPOT-project are SINTEF (leader of work package 1), the Norwegian Mapping Authority (leader of work package 2), The Norwegian Public Roads Administration, Aventi, Applied Autonomy and NTNU. All partners have contributed to the content of this report.
